Sibling rivalry over a family secret

Stanley Ho

For decades, Winnie Ho Yuen-ki kept a large secret. As sibling rivalry with tycoon Stanley Ho Hung-sun started hitting the headlines, so too would the details of her past become public knowledge.

In 2004, Ms Ho shared details of this secret with journalist Barry Wain. For decades, her son Michael Mak Shun-ming had been oblivious to the fact that his real father was patriarch Eric Hotung. It was a fact she claimed Mr Ho had known, and had led to problems between them.

It was only at the age of 41 that Mr Mak was to learn the truth, although he had previously been told by other relatives of his real parentage, but had not believed them. Ms Ho and Mr Mak are very close, according to family members. The same cannot be said for two other children of Ms Ho's - Anita and Winston Mak.

The two are suing Ms Ho in a separate action to have the Macau courts recognise she is their mother, and that she should leave some of her shareholding in STDM to them. As it is an issue being fought in the Macau courts, Ms Ho's residency will be a key issue. According to family members, Ms Ho gave up her Portuguese passport and now holds a Hong Kong document.
